How does the forex market affect the volatility of cryptocurrencies?

Can you explain the relationship between the forex market and the volatility of cryptocurrencies? How does the forex market impact the price fluctuations of digital currencies?

- Kajal KesharwaniJun 13, 2020 · 5 years agoThe forex market and cryptocurrencies are closely connected. As the largest financial market in the world, the forex market influences various aspects of the cryptocurrency market, including its volatility. When there are significant changes in the forex market, such as fluctuations in major currency pairs, it can have a ripple effect on cryptocurrencies. Traders and investors often use forex as a benchmark to evaluate the strength or weakness of a particular currency, which can impact the demand for cryptocurrencies. Additionally, forex trading can also affect the liquidity of cryptocurrencies, as traders may choose to convert their fiat currencies into digital assets or vice versa based on forex market trends.
- SiddharthAug 08, 2025 · 14 days agoThe forex market plays a crucial role in shaping the volatility of cryptocurrencies. When there is high volatility in the forex market, it can lead to increased volatility in the cryptocurrency market as well. This is because many traders and investors use forex as a hedging tool to manage risks in their cryptocurrency investments. For example, if there is a sudden depreciation in a major currency, traders may sell off their cryptocurrencies to minimize losses. This selling pressure can cause a drop in cryptocurrency prices and increase overall market volatility. On the other hand, positive developments in the forex market, such as a strengthening of a major currency, can boost investor confidence and lead to increased demand for cryptocurrencies, resulting in higher volatility.
